Circuit Breaker
Control and selection of the circuit
breaker
Circuit breaker control mode
selection and control mode of substation, the size
of
the
substation
and
other
factors.
Substation
control
mode
is
different,
different
size, circuit breaker control mode also
vary accordingly.
According
to the
working
voltage
of
control
circuit, the
circuit
breaker
control
mode
can
be
divided
into
two
kinds
of,
heavy
current
and
weak
current
control.
According
to
the
operation
mode,
can
be
divided
into
one
control
two
kinds
of
control and line selection.
So-called high voltage control, is from
the control equipment of commands to
the circuit breaker operating
mechanism, the working voltage of the control
circuit
for
dc
110
v
or
220
v.
According
to
the
control
site,
divided
into
two
kinds
of
centralized
control
and
local
control;
According
to
the
jump,
switching
circuit
monitoring,
divided
into
two
kinds
of
lighting
monitoring
and
audio
surveillance;
According
to
the
connection
of
control
circuit
is
divided
into
control
switch
has
a
fixed
position
is
not
corresponding
to
the
connection
with
control
switch
contact
automatic reset.
Weak current control can be divided
into the following two cases.
(1)
the
working
voltage
of
circuit
breaker
control
circuit
into
two
parts,
low
voltage
and
heavy
current
issue
commands
control
equipment
is
working
voltage
weak current is
usually 48 v. Command is issued, and then through
the middle and
weak electricity
conversion link weak current signal conversion to
high voltage signal,
command, to the
circuit breaker operating mechanism. Intermediate
conversion links
between circuit
breaker and at the same structure and high voltage
control circuit.
This
weak
current
control,
is
essentially
the
layout
on
the
control
panel
of
weak
electrochemical control equipment.
(2)
from
the
control
equipment
to
the
working
voltage
of
circuit
breaker
operating
mechanism
of
all
circuits
are
all
elv.
This
way
of
command
signal
transmission distance is relatively
close, the circuit breaker operation and power is
large, it is not suitable for 220500 kv
substation.
Low voltage
line selection control wiring is more complex,
more operation steps,
hard
to
ensure
its
reliability.
220-500
kv
substation
circuit
breaker,
do
not
recommend
using low voltage line selection control.
Common characteristic is
due to the weak current control on the control
panel
using the miniaturization of the
weak current control device, the control panel on
the
unit area can be assigned by the
control loop. Under the condition of same number
of controlled object, compared with the
high voltage control, can reduce the area of
the
control
panel,
convenient
monitoring
and
operational
personnel;
Reduced
the
master
control
room
construction
area,
reduce the
investment in
civil
engineering.
This is a major
advantage of the weak current control. But weak
current equipment
there is
insufficient, low voltage terminal and weak
current equipment of electrical
insulation distance is small, be afraid
of dust, especially under the condition of dust
containing conductive material more
dangerous; Weak current equipment terminals
and screen after the weak current
connection terminals and soft line connection with
welding,
due
to
close
the
distance
between
the
terminal,
when
check
line
and
cleaning pay special
attention to prevent short circuit between
terminals; In addition,
there
is
low
mechanical
strength,
off
contact
capacity
small,
poor
anti-
jamming
performance shortcomings.
High voltage control can be divided
into high voltage one to one direct control
and
high
voltage
line
selection
control.
Very
few
of
the
latter
in
the
practical
engineering applications. High voltage
one to one direct control method has simple
control circuit, power supply voltage
of a single operation, the operation personnel
easy to grasp, convenient maintenance,
high reliability advantages, all kinds of used
in substation is put into operation a
major control method.
High
voltage
control,
because
of
the
working
voltage
of
control
equipment
is
higher, to meet the requirements of
insulation distance, control equipment, terminal
equipment such as the volume is big,
and within the unit area on the control panel
can decorate less control goes back
from them. In substation scale, more cases of the
object, and the control panel. This not
only increases the surface area of the main
control room, increasing the cost of
civil engineering, at the same time, due to the
large surveillance plane, is
unfavorable to the normal monitoring and
operation.

When
in
breaker
control
circuit
design
should
pay
attention
to
the
following
basic
requirements.
(1) shall
have the monitoring circuit of the control power.
Circuit breaker control
power is the
most important, once lost power supply, circuit
breaker can't operate.
Whatever
the
reason,
therefore,
when
the
circuit
breaker
control
power
supply
disappears,
should
sound
and
light
signals,
prompt
the
personnel
on
duty
timely
processing.
(2)
should be regularly monitored circuit breaker
jump, switching circuit integrity,
when
tripping or switching circuit malfunction, should
signal circuit breaker control
circuit
disconnection.
(3) should
be prevent electric lock circuit breaker
breaker is very dangerous, easy to
cause body damage, even caused an explosion of
the
circuit
breaker,
so
blocking
measures
must
be
taken.
At
present,
the
microcomputer protection device and the
operation of the circuit breaker loop in the
default
configuration,
have
prevent
breaker
electrical
circuits.
Practical
application, use and can only use one
to prevent the circuit breaker electric circuits
of the
part of the circuit.
